Dillons
103 Diagonal St
Elizabeth, IL 61028
Dillons is a charming department store located in the heart of Elizabeth, IL. Known for its friendly service and diverse selection, Dillons offers a range of products from clothing and home goods to groceries. This local favorite provides a convenient shopping experience for residents and visitors alike, making it a must-visit destination in the area.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.